MEASUREMENTS

To fit ages 6-12 (12-18) (24-36) (36-48) months.

Actual measurements 56.5 (65) (73) (81.5) cm/22¼ (25½) (28¾) (32) in.

Side seam 15.5 (19.5) (21.5) (25.5) cm/6 (7½) (8½) (10) in.

Length to shoulder 28 (32) (36) (40) cm/11 (12½) (14) (15¾) in.

Sleeve seam with cuff turned back 18 (20) (22) (24) cm/ 7 (8) (8½) (9½) in.

MATERIALS

3 (4) (4) (5) 100g (212m) balls of Sirdar Cotton DK (100% cotton) in Seafoam (542)*. Pair each of 3.75mm (No. 9) and 4mm (No. 8) knitting needles; a cable needle; removable stitch markers or contrast thread; safety pins or small stitch holders. Yarn is available from theknittingnetwork.com

TENSION

22 stitches and 28 rows, to 10 x 10cm, over stocking stitch, using 4mm
